#3b57db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b57db is composed of 23.1% red, 34.1%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.1% cyan, 60.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 229.5 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 54.5%. #3b57db color hex could be obtained by blending #76aeff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#3b57db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3b57db has RGB values of R:59, G:87,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 3889115.

Shades and Tints of #3b57db
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f1f3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b57db
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828594 is the less saturated color, while #1740ff is the most saturated one.
